ENRON AND THE NEW ECONOMY
Abstract
A quote from Gary Hamel and C.K. Prahalad's book Competing for the Future‐provides a useful framework for new economy companies like Enron to live by. To quote Hamel and Prahalad: “To be a leader, a company must take charge of the process of industry transformation.” Enron has been at the forefront of change in the energy industry since its formation in 1985—and more recently it has been an active agent for change in the broadband communications and the global e‐commerce industries. Today Enron is a $50 billion dollar company with 17,900 employees.
